A trailer brake shoe refers to a part that expands outward under the force of camshaft or push rod to press the brake drum and play the role of braking. It is installed on the axle through the brake bracket. It is one of the key safety components in the automobile braking system.

As shown in Figure 1 below. A brake shoe is a matching part of internal tension shoe friction brakes. And the other matching part is a brake drum. When working, it bears the thrust of camshaft, the reverse force, tangential force and support reaction force of external brake drum. It shall have the strength and appropriate stiffness, and the supporting brake lining on the brake shoe shall have as high and stable friction coefficient as possible.

Brake shoes are widely used on axles of semi-trailers.


As shown in Figure 2 below. The brake shoe assembly is mainly composed of brake shoes, brake linings and rivets. The brake linings are riveted to the brake shoes through rivets, and the brake shoes are composed of rib plates and panels.

1. Classification of brake shoes


(1) Casting brake shoes


As shown in Figure 3 below. This kind of brake shoe is integrally formed by casting process, which has the following advantages over pressing and welding brake shoe:


① Good product consistency. The casting process can ensure the consistency of products.


② The product has strong rigidity. This can avoid the problem of weak brakes to a certain extent. Heavy-duty trucks generally use cast brake shoes.


With the further development of automobile lightweight and the improvement of environmental protection requirements, the brake shoe is gradually converted to pressing and welding process.

(2) Pressing and welding brake shoes


As shown in Figure 4 below. This kind of brake shoe is made of steel plates under pressing and welding process, with high market share. Compared with the traditional casting process, it has the following advantages:


① Light weight. Under the same specifications, the brake shoe is about 20% lighter than the cast brake shoe, which is more in line with the development trend of automobile lightweight.

② Better performance. Because the pressing and welding brake shoes

are made of steel plates, the steel plates have a certain elasticity. During braking, the brake lining fits more closely with the brake drum, and the braking effect is better. At the same time, due to the light weight of the brake shoe, the braking reaction time is shortened.


③ The unequal thickness design of brake lining can be realized. The brake lining is more fully utilized to improve the service life of the brake lining.


④ Low manufacturing cost and high production efficiency. The pressing and welding process is relatively simple and the processing cycle is short, which can avoid the production pressure required by mass casting blanks.

⑤ Good social benefits. Pressing and welding process replaces casting process, which has low environmental pollution only.

2. Technical parameters of brake shoes


As shown in Figure 5 below. The main technical parameters of brake drum shoes are as follows:

Schematic diagram of a brake shoe parameters

Figure 5. Schematic diagram of a brake shoe parameters


(1) A:Center distance between support pin and roller pin

(2) B:Brake shoe width

(3) H:Center height

(4) R:Radius of braking surface

(5) D1:Diameter of support pin

(6) D2:Diameter of roller pin

5. Brake shoe warranty description


The quality warranty of brake shoes of heavy duty vehicles is generally as follows:


① Brake shoes for semi trailers : 3 years or 500,000 km

② Brake shoes for heavy duty trucks: 2 years or 500,000 km.


Quality warranty is generally limited to use on expressways or ordinary roads. It does not include normal wear and tear, improper use, improper installation, traffic accident, improper maintenance or any other situation that may be regarded as causing product failure. The specific situation shall be subject to the manufacturer's instructions.

Note: Brake linings are vulnerable parts and are not covered by the warranty
